çatlatmakto crack / to burst

Çatlatmak means 'to crack' or 'to burst' something, often implying a sudden, forceful action or a breaking point. In the song, it's used with the onomatopoeic repetition 'çat çat çatlatmaksa', which vividly emphasizes the sound and action of cracking or breaking.

Edis uses this word to describe the intention of causing extreme emotional distress, as if someone's heart or patience is being pushed to its breaking point. It's a powerful and evocative word that captures a feeling of intense pressure and impending collapse.

Get ready for a rollercoaster of emotions with Edis's hit song, "Martılar"! At its heart, this is a song about deep heartbreak and a desperate plea for a lover to return. The singer feels that life without their partner is like death itself. He's willing to become their "slave" and begs them to come back, not just for his sake, but for the sad seagulls ("martılar") who will miss them too!

But it's not all sadness! The song has a fiery, defiant twist. While he's going crazy on lonely nights, he also declares that if his ex is trying to make him jealous, he'll dance defiantly to show he's strong. It's a powerful mix of vulnerability and pride, capturing that feeling of trying to move on while still being completely in love. He believes no one can understand a love this intense unless they've experienced it themselves.
